| Objective:The aim of this study was to assess the anti-caries effect of Arnebia euchroma(Royle)Johnst.root(AR)extract through experiments with bacteria and animal.Methods:(1)The effect of the extractive from the AR on Streptococcus mutans(S.mutans)was verified by in vitro bacteriostatic experiments.The minimal inhibit concentration(MIC50)of AR extract against S.mutans planktonic cultures was determined by broth microdilution.The minimum bactericidal concentration(MBC)of AR extract against S.mutans was determined by the streak-plating method.The minimum biofilm inhibition concentration(MBIC50)and minimum biofilm reduction concentration(MBRC50)of S.mutans were determined by microtiter plate assay.The live/dead bacterial staining were conducted to monitor bacterial growth state in biofilm form to observe the effective of the AR extract.The adhesion amount of S.mutans labeled with fluorescent to saliva-coated hydroxyapatite was measured to determine the effect of the MBIC50 and four concentrations gradients sub-MBIC50 of the AR extract on the adhesion of S.mutans.(2)The anti-caries effect of the AR extract was verified by in vivo Animal experimentation.The S.mutans count in the saliva of rats was counted by plate dilution method.X-ray film and Keyes score reflected the severity of dental caries in rats.The voids and gaps in demineralized enamel was detected by CLSM.The above methods comprehensively evaluate the effectiveness of AR extract in preventing caries in vivo.The weight gain,HE staining of oral mucosa and organ coefficients of rats during the test were recorded to comprehensively evaluate the safety of the anti-caries effect of AR extract.Results:The MIC50 of AR extract against S.mutans planktonic cultures and the MBC are 1mg/m L and 8mg/m L respectively.The MBIC50 and the MBRC50 of the AR extract to the S.mutans biofilm are 4 mg/m L and 8mg/m L respectively,8mg/m L and 4mg/m L can affect the ratio of dead bacteria in biofilm(P<0.05),2mg/m L can affect biofilm structure.The adhesion inhibition ability of AR extract on S.mutans is in direct proportion to the drug concentration,the three concentrations of 4 mg/m L and below showed adhesion inhibition(P<0.001),and the adhesion rate at 1 mg/m L concentration is 50%.1mg/m L and 2mg/m L AR extract can reduce the amount of S.mutans in saliva of rats,0.5mg/m L AR extract can reduce the slightly dentinal caries scores and 1mg/m L and 2mg/m L AR extract can reduce moderate dentinal caries scores and extensive dentinal caries scores,reduce the severity of caries.AR extract has no systemic toxic and side effects in vivo.Conclusion:The extract of AR can effectively inhibit the growth and adhesion of the main cariogenic bacteria and their biofilms in vitro;In vivo,it can inhibit the formation and development of rat dental caries,and prevent and cure rat dental caries safely and effectively. |
